The Allure of Rare Books


Rare books are more than just old pages bound together; they are windows into history, culture, and the evolution of thought. Each book tells a story, not just through its content but also through its physical form, provenance, and the journey it has taken to reach your hands.


What Makes a Book Rare?


Several factors contribute to a book's rarity:


  • Limited Editions: Books published in small quantities often become highly sought after.

  • Historical Significance: Works that have influenced society or culture can gain value over time.

  • Unique Features: First editions, signed copies, or books with original illustrations can be particularly valuable.

  • Condition: The physical state of a book plays a crucial role in its rarity and value.


Understanding these factors can enhance your appreciation for rare books and guide your collecting journey.

Collecting Rare Books


For those interested in starting their own collection, here are some tips to consider:


Define Your Focus


Decide what types of books interest you the most. This could be based on genre, author, or historical significance. Having a clear focus will make your collecting journey more enjoyable and meaningful.


Research and Educate Yourself


Knowledge is key in the world of rare books. Read books, attend lectures, and join collector groups to learn more about the market and what to look for in a valuable book.


Attend Book Fairs and Auctions


Book fairs and auctions are excellent opportunities to discover rare finds. They also provide a chance to network with other collectors and dealers.


Build Relationships with Dealers


Establishing a rapport with reputable dealers, like those at Libris Mundi, can be invaluable. They can offer insights, notify you of new arrivals, and help you find specific titles.

Digital vs. Physical


While digital books offer convenience, they lack the tactile experience and aesthetic pleasure of holding a physical book. Collectors appreciate the craftsmanship, smell, and feel of rare books, which cannot be replicated in a digital format.
